🙂A single person spends $1,236 per month in Port Elizabeth vs $1,396 in Ubud, Bali, rent included.
🙂A couple spends around $1,900 per month in Port Elizabeth vs $2,334 in Ubud, Bali, rent included.
🙂A family of three spends $2,563 per month in Port Elizabeth vs $3,273 in Ubud, Bali, rent included.
🙂Port Elizabeth is about 11% cheaper than Ubud, Bali, driven mainly by Groceries & Markets.
📊Port Elizabeth sits 10% below the global median, while Ubud, Bali is 2% above – they fall on opposite sides of the world average.

🏠A central one-bedroom costs $633 in Port Elizabeth versus $1,117 in Ubud, Bali. Rent is usually the largest line item in a monthly budget, so the gap here sets the tone for the overall comparison.
💰Salaries run about 867% higher in Port Elizabeth, which reinforces the cost advantage – you earn more and spend less. Purchasing power leans clearly in its favor.
🛒A mid-range dinner for two costs $44.00 in Port Elizabeth versus $39.00 in Ubud, Bali. Groceries tell a different story – $203 in Port Elizabeth vs $293 in Ubud, Bali – so Port Elizabeth wins on supermarket bills even if dining out costs more.
